#d4f1fa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4f1fa is composed of 83.1% red, 94.5%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.2% cyan, 3.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 194.2 degrees, a saturation of 79.2% and a lightness of 90.6%. #d4f1fa color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a9e3f5.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

#d4f1fa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4f1fa has RGB values of R:212, G:241,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 13955578.
